Jack Roush In Hospital After Plane Crash

jack roush at Jack Roush In Hospital After Plane Crash

The legendary American race driver and tuner Jack Roush has been seriously injured after he crashed his Hawker Beechcraft Premier jet at Wittman Regional Airport in OshKosh, Wisconsin. It’s his second plane crash, but this time he got clipped pretty badly and he had to be hospitalized. Dr. Kevin Wasco, the attending physician, said that Roush is in serious but stable condition. His injuries are not life threatening.

Roush’s last project was the SR-71 Mustang he developed in collaboration with Carroll Shelby for charity. We wish him a speeding recovery. [picture: Roushperformacne]
